edit: ajout d'une série de fenêtre flottantes déplaçable avec sytème de focus + transformation msgVisualizer en composant séparé et réglages associés

This commit is contained in:
2026-03-20 04:36:56 +01:00
parent bb0ac827bb
commit 6cd8a2e634
14 changed files with 667 additions and 125 deletions
+16
View File
@@ -6,11 +6,19 @@ import App from './App.vue'
// import composants
import TitleContent from './components/TitleContent.vue'
import InfoContent from './components/InfoContent.vue'
//title
import TitleText from './titleComponents/TitleText.vue'
import GeneratedContent from './titleComponents/GeneratedContent.vue'
import MusicPlayer from './titleComponents/MusicPlayer.vue'
//info
import InfoMenu from './infoComponents/InfoMenu.vue'
import InboxContent from './infoComponents/InboxContent.vue'
//indie
import ArtistPannel from './indieComponents/ArtistPannel.vue'
import NewsletterPannel from './indieComponents/NewsletterPannel.vue'
import ContactPannel from './indieComponents/ContactPannel.vue'
import InstaPannel from './indieComponents/InstaPannel.vue'
import MessagePannel from './indieComponents/MessagePannel.vue'
// création app racine
const app = createApp(App);
@@ -18,11 +26,19 @@ const app = createApp(App);
//Composants
app.component('TitleDiv', TitleContent);
app.component('InfoDiv', InfoContent);
//title
app.component('PlayerDiv', MusicPlayer);
app.component('TitleTextDiv', TitleText);
app.component('GeneratedDiv',GeneratedContent);
//info
app.component('InfoMenuDiv', InfoMenu);
app.component('InboxDiv', InboxContent);
//indie
app.component('ArtistPan', ArtistPannel);
app.component('NewsPan', NewsletterPannel);
app.component('ContactPan', ContactPannel);
app.component('InstaPan', InstaPannel);
app.component('MessagePan', MessagePannel);
//Montage dans div#app de index.html
app.mount('#app');